Presidential Search Update

Our search consultants from Storbeck Search have been engaged in an active national recruitment effort to build an impressive and diverse pool of candidates. The Buffalo State Presidential Search Committee has completed virtual face-to-face video interviews, and we are pleased to announce that the committee has identified a small group of candidates with whom we will schedule additional meetings.

While we had hoped to conduct this search using an open search model, based on the ability to attract and retain these top candidates, SUNY has approved the decision to use a representational search model. In this competitive market, and to protect the professionals we are engaging, it is essential to the process that the names of the candidates remain confidential throughout the process. This means that semifinalists’ names will not be provided to the campus community.

SUNY approved the decision based on extensive consultation with Storbeck Search, the Presidential Search Committee, and the Buffalo State Council and based on recent and past precedent from SUNY presidential searches. This decision was made after careful consideration upon learning that the open search process with public campus meetings would have had a significant negative impact on the candidate pool. To maintain a strong, robust, and diverse applicant pool, this change will serve Buffalo State University’s best interest for its faculty, students, and community. We are committed to ensuring our institution’s strong leadership continuity, and we see this transition as a crucial step toward achieving that.

We will use SUNY’s guidance for this type of search. During a representational search, members of the Buffalo State Council and other designated members of the Buffalo State campus community will be invited to meet with the semifinalist candidates under strict rules of confidentiality. Confidentiality is vital to this model to retain the selected candidates. The structure and makeup of the Presidential Search Committee ensures that all areas of the university have “a voice” in the process.

The Presidential Search Committee and a selection of other campus constituents will confidentially meet with the finalists. The Presidential Search Committee will meet to review feedback from the final interviews, as well as feedback from references, and together will weigh the merits of each of the finalists.

The Buffalo State Council will vote to recommend three finalists to the chancellor and the SUNY Board of Trustees. The chancellor and the SUNY Board of Trustees will meet with the three finalists, the chancellor will make his recommendation to the SUNY Board of Trustees, and the trustees will vote to choose our next president.
